|
FPGA-Online Advanced Course (VHDL) (FPGAadvanced)2.5 ECTS (englische Bezeichnung: FPGA-Online Advanced Course (VHDL))
Modulverantwortliche/r: Daniel Ziener Lehrende:
Daniel Ziener, Andreas Becher
Startsemester: |
SS 2015 | Dauer: |
1 Semester | Turnus: |
halbjährlich (WS+SS) |
Präsenzzeit: |
0 Std. | Eigenstudium: |
75 Std. | Sprache: |
Deutsch |
Lehrveranstaltungen:
Empfohlene Voraussetzungen:
Es wird empfohlen, folgende Module zu absolvieren, bevor dieses Modul belegt wird:
FPGA-Online Basic Course with VHDL (WS 2014/2015)
Inhalt:
In the course "FPGA-Online Advanced Course with VHDL" you will learn
advanced techniques to program an FPGA. These techniques include:
Script-based synthesis, place and route, and loading of the FPGA, the
use of the high speed interface PCI Express, and the use of special
hardware blocks on the FPGA. The techniques are applied on the example
application of hardware accelerated video compression and decompression. Outline:
1. Introduction to the lab environment
2. Getting started with the Xilinx design flow
3. Generating and customizing a PCIe-interface with the Xilinx Core
Generator
4. Transmitting pictures to the FPGA and back
5. Creating a simple JPEG en/decoder
6. Creating a JPEG en/decoder using extremeDSP
7. Creating the final video coder
Lernziele und Kompetenzen:
- Verstehen
-
- Anwenden
- Die Studierenden erlernen den Entwurf von FPGA-basierten Systemen auf eine individuelle Aufgabestellung anzuwenden.
- Erschaffen
- Die Studierenden entwerfen eigene VHDL-Module.
Literatur:
ASHENDEN, P. J., 2008. The Designer's Guide to VHDL. Morgan Kaufmann.
Organisatorisches:
Dies ist ein Fortgeschrittenenkurs. Inhalt des Kurses "FPGA-Online Basic Course with VHDL (FPGAonline)" bzw. Erfahrung mit FPGAs (bevorzugt Xilinx) und VHDL wird als Wissen vorausgesetzt.
Dieser Kurs ist ein Online Kurs. Lehrinhalte werden in Form von ausgearbeiteten Inhalten online zur Verfügung gestellt und sollen sich
im Selbststudium angeeignet werden. Übungsaufgaben werden ebenfalls
online gestellt. Die entwickelten Lösungen können in unserem online-remote Labor getestet werden. Betreuung während des Kurses findet durch unsere Übungsleiter und Tutoren, in Form von E-Mails, Forum, Chat und Skype statt.
Weitere Informationen:
Schlüsselwörter: FPGA, VHDL, Online-Kurs
www: http://www12.informatik.uni-erlangen.de/edu/fpga-online/
Verwendbarkeit des Moduls / Einpassung in den Musterstudienplan: Das Modul ist im Kontext der folgenden Studienfächer/Vertiefungsrichtungen verwendbar:
- Informatik (Master of Science)
(Po-Vers. 2010 | Wahlpflichtbereich | Säule der systemorientierten Vertiefungsrichtungen | Vertiefungsmodul Hardware-Software-Co-Design)
Studien-/Prüfungsleistungen:
FPGA-Online Advanced Course (VHDL) (Prüfungsnummer: 897853)
- Prüfungsleistung, mündliche Prüfung, Dauer (in Minuten): 30, benotet
- Anteil an der Berechnung der Modulnote: 100.0 %
- Erstablegung: SS 2015, 1. Wdh.: WS 2015/2016
|
|
|
|
UnivIS ist ein Produkt der Config eG, Buckenhof |
|
|